00:41:24There are two towns near each other.
00:41:26People who always tell the truth live in one of them.
00:41:29Liars live in the other.
00:41:30The inhabitants of the towns often visit each other.
00:41:33What questions should you ask a passerby to find out which town you're in?
00:41:47Ask them, are you a guest here?
00:41:49If they answer yes, you're in the town of liars.
00:41:52If they say no, you're in the town where honest people live.
00:41:56When it's raining, the cat is either in the room or in the basement.
00:42:00When the cat is in the room, the mouse is in the burrow, and the cheese is in the fridge.
00:42:05If the cheese is on the table, and the cat is in the basement, the mouse is in the room.
00:42:10Right now, it's raining, and the cheese is on the table.
00:42:13Where are the cat and the mouse?
00:42:24The cat can be in two places, either in the room or in the basement.
00:42:28But at the moment, the cat can't be in the room because the cheese is not in the fridge,
00:42:32it's on the table.
00:42:34It means the cat is in the basement.
00:42:36And since the cheese is on the table, and the cat is in the basement, the mouse must
00:42:40be in the room.

01:12:23Ailu is a fairy who needs to fly to a village on the other side of the forest for some fairy business.
01:12:30The problem is that the trip there takes six days.
01:12:34But one fairy can only carry four packs of pixie dust,
01:12:37and one is only enough for one day.
01:12:40There's no chance of getting more pixie dust midway.
01:12:44It's all stored in the villages.
01:12:47So, Ailu should take some helpers on the trip with her.
01:12:51How many helpers does she need?
01:12:53And what should be her strategy to reach the other village?
01:13:07Ailu will need two helpers.
01:13:09Let's call them B and C.
01:13:11Each of them will have a four-day supply of pixie dust.
01:13:15So the three of them will have 12 packs.
01:13:18During the first day, they will all be using the pixie dust B is carrying.
01:13:23So they'll use three out of four packs.
01:13:26At the end of the day, B will fly back to the village.
01:13:30And Ailu and C will keep going.
01:13:33The remaining pack of pixie dust will be enough for B to make it back home safely.
01:13:38On the second day, Ailu and C will be using the pixie dust C is carrying.
01:13:44So they'll use two by the end of the day.
01:13:47Then C will go home.
01:13:49The road back home will take her two days.
01:13:52And the two packs will be enough for her to return.
01:13:56Ailu will continue her journey alone.
01:13:58It'll be just four more days.
01:14:00But she'll still have her four packs of pixie dust to make it there.

01:34:10One guy snuck into a fruit store
01:34:12and wanted to steal some fruit.
01:34:14He took four bananas,
01:34:15two apples,
01:34:16a watermelon,
01:34:17and a pineapple.
01:34:18But suddenly,
01:34:19someone grabbed his hand.
01:34:20It was the store owner.
01:34:22He said,
01:34:23I'll let you go
01:34:24if you solve my riddle.
01:34:25A pineapple and an apple
01:34:26cost $18.
01:34:28Three apples cost $15.
01:34:30Half a watermelon
01:34:31and two bananas cost $12.
01:34:33So, how much do four bananas
01:34:35and a pineapple cost?
01:34:39A watermelon,
01:34:40two apples,
01:34:41and a pineapple cost.
01:34:43The guy thought for a minute
01:34:44and said something.
01:34:45After that,
01:34:46the store owner let him go.
01:34:48What answer did the guy give?
01:34:59The guy said
01:35:00that the fruit cost $47.
01:35:02If three apples are $15,
01:35:04then one apple is $5.
01:35:06Knowing this,
01:35:07we can figure out
01:35:08that the cost of the pineapple,
01:35:09$18 minus $5,
01:35:11equals $13.
01:35:13And if half a watermelon
01:35:14and two bananas are $12,
01:35:16then a whole watermelon
01:35:17and four bananas cost $24.
01:35:20And if we sum it all up,
01:35:22we'll get $47.
